Placements: Here in Silicon, the placement is good but not the best. Look if you are capable of getting the job, then you will be selected in the campus. So about 70% or more of the seniors batch got the job but in only the IT companies. No core companies recruit the students means no core sector companies come to the campus. Talking about the salary, the companies offer around 25-35K per month. The companies like Capgemini, Infosys, Wipro, and Tech Mahindra visit the campus.
Infrastructure: Silicon does possess good classrooms, library, laboratory, and medical facility. The Wi-Fi facility is the worst thing in Silicon. The speed here is less than the 2G speed of any network. Coming to network, only you can use Airtel and Vodafone. You will see zero networks of any other sim. Coming to sports, there are two basketball courts, one small ground, where both cricket and football were played. When we talk about hostel rooms, they can be better. There are issues with water supply, internet, and the warden. The canteen food is also good, but that depends on the days like in Wednesdays, Fridays, Sundays, and you will get a little bit good food than other days. The college infrastructure is not large but small. But it's also good that you don't have to be in a hurry for the classes.
Faculty: The best thing in Silicon is the teaching part because that's why students come here. Here, the teachers are good, well-qualified, and knowledgeable. In a day, we have to attend a minimum of 5 classes and a lab in a day. The teachers are strict too. If you aim for GATE or CAT, then you should be here, and also you have to study for this too. There are faculty members too who will help you much in industry exposure is a little bit less. But in the 2nd and 3rd-year, you will be visited a minimum of two industries, but that should improve in Silicon. The course curriculum is useful but not that 100% because it's under BPUT, and the institute must follow them.
Other: If we talk about the campus, it's a little bit small, but the crowd is good. Every year, there's one fest combining the tech fest and spring fest of 3-days. Here, the surroundings are good and greenery. There is one sports club and music club for the extracurricular activities. You will also get a gym but with no trainers.

Great Placements during our time that is in 2016. Wipro hired 294 students in on campus on day one.
Placements: Placement is better for IT sector jobs than core jobs here. Actually it has one more branches in Bhubaneswar which has much better infrastructure and faculty members compared to Sambalpur branch. Companies such as Infosys, Wipro, Techmahindra, Capgemini, TCS (off-campus) generally come to this college. So I would suggest to go for CS/IT branch for getting easy jobs in IT field.
Infrastructure: Infrastructure is quite good. As an Electrical Branch student I can say that the equipment are available relevant to the syllabus suggested by BPUT. But faculty members especially the lab assistants are not as qualified to teach or make student understand the basics of assessment in lab. Wi-Fi facilities are available. Sports and games are also played and they compete with other colleges.
Faculty: The teachers are always helpful. Most of the teachers especially in electrical and CS branch are highly qualified and knowledgeable. They use projectors to make student understand better and clear way. Industry exposure is hard to gain from this college. This type of curriculum can only help you in passing the B.Tech.
Other: Techfest happens every year. Sports events with rhytmnova, a musical events also happens every year. Extra curricular activities such as quiz, robotics, dance etc. Also happens every year.
